Output 01f70062492881e94e80e1e54837a4d1f55b7aa5fed67e64f211b0cf51504c05:21

value
1678422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fcf5cc6796d55ecd3baf6df342f128615ec998c OP_EQUAL
address
3EoQxmVQrHbjqqX5EHyp1y7NZgpJ5nA6AQ
transaction
01f70062492881e94e80e1e54837a4d1f55b7aa5fed67e64f211b0cf51504c05
spent
true